    Good shout simmo, Lovcen goes really well around Aintree and should be in the shake-up today.

    Aiden O'Brien sends out his impressive Clonmel hurdle winner Carriganog in the 2.50 at Wexford today. That win at Clonmel was enough to get J.P. McManus reaching for his cheque book and Carriganog runs in the famous green and gold hoops for the first time today.

    Over at Galway, the Gigginstown Stud should be among the winners with Very Wood (1.25) and Shrapnel (3.35) looking to hold outstanding chances. I was particularly impressed by Shrapnel on his chasing debut - he looked beaten after a slowish jump at the last but Davy Russell got a terrific response from him up the run-in and he collared Barry Geraghty on Usa in the shadow of the post.

    Over at Wincanton, King's Lodge looked like a horse going places when bolting up on his seasonal debut at Fontwell and he can defy a 9lbs rise to score again here (the corks will be popping in Chuckle Towers if he can win for old boy Ponsonby and the forum's favourite trainer). Despite carrying top weight, Highland Lodge can continue Emma Lavelle's fine form by taking the Desert Orchid Silver Cup. The Flemensfirth gelding has won on seasonal debut for the last 2 seasons and conditions should be ideal for him today.

    At Aintree Alan King sends out an interesting juvenile in the opener, the Simon Munir owned Memberof, whilst in the 3.15 Uncle Jimmy should give a good account having finished a very close second behind Kangaroo Court on his seasonal reappearance.

    Best of luck everyone <ok>
